AUTOMATION TECHNOLOGIES, LLCProfession (Job Category): Project/Program ManagementJob Schedule: Full timeRemote: NoJob Description: Position SummaryOversees multiple interconnected and installed automation projects, requiring a blend of technical expertise, strategic leadership, and service acumen to implement, support, and optimize automated systems across a customer portfolio. Key responsibilities include collaborating with stakeholders to identify automation upgrade opportunities, developing and managing project roadmaps, leading cross-functional teams, and ensuring solutions align with business goals and standards. Required qualifications typically include experience in project management, a strong technical background in automation, excellent communication and leadership skills, and a strategic mindset focused on process improvement and risk management. Key Responsibilities* Strategic Planning: Manage a portfolio of automation projects aligned with strategic business goals and customer deployments Job Title: Aftermarket Program Manager Reports to: VP of Aftermarket Classification: Exempt Responsibilities of the Position * Lifecycle Management: Support customer needs including point of contact on all ongoing activities in the support realm, including T&M service, contract fulfillment, preventative maintenance deliverables and upgrade prioritization. * Cross-Functional Collaboration: Work with various departments (IT, engineering, operations, etc.) to understand requirements, ensure alignment, and gather feedback. * Stakeholder Management: Communicate project status, risks, and outcomes to stakeholders and senior leadership. * Process Improvement: Analyze existing processes to identify areas for automation and OEE improvement and drive continuous improvement initiatives. * Technical Oversight: Provide technical direction, develop best practices and standards, and ensure the reliability and scalability of implemented solutions. * Team Leadership: Lead and mentor project managers and teams, providing guidance, resolving conflicts, and fostering a collaborative culture. * Risk and Compliance: Manage risks across multiple projects and ensure solutions comply with industry standards and business requirements.
